Output 8bab154a054751bb3e7463a029534f7ffe7fe3d5e9dfcf8c0b3f1eb6d4fa1989:14

value
12074378
script pubkey
OP_0 OP_PUSHBYTES_20 69d32778d526b329c3128bffcb0c254a5a85ff0d
address
bc1qd8fjw7x4y6ejnscj30lukrp9ffdgtlcde5y2kz
transaction
8bab154a054751bb3e7463a029534f7ffe7fe3d5e9dfcf8c0b3f1eb6d4fa1989
spent
true